R-Programmierungs-Kurse können Ihnen helfen zu lernen, wie Daten analysiert, visualisiert und statistisch ausgewertet werden. Sie können Fähigkeiten in Syntax, Funktionen, Paketen und Modellen aufbauen. Viele Kurse stellen Workflows und Beispiele aus Datenprojekten vor.

Johns Hopkins University
Kompetenzen, die Sie erwerben: AI-Personalisierung, Soziologie, Datenanalyse, Datenerfassung, Datenumwandlung, Medien und Kommunikation, Netzwerkanalyse, Anwendungsprogrammierschnittstelle (API), Forschung, Statistische Analyse, Analyse sozialer Medien, Analytische Fähigkeiten, Persuasive Kommunikation, Psychologie, Sozialwissenschaften, Auszug, Analyse sozialer Netzwerke, Datenerhebung, Skripting
Mittel · Kurs · 1–3 Monate

Kompetenzen, die Sie erwerben: Peripheral Devices, Hardware Troubleshooting, Desktop Support, Computer Hardware, Technical Support, System Requirements, System Configuration, Display Devices, Issue Tracking, Patch Management, Data Storage, Usability, Memory Management
Anfänger ·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: Data Structures, Graph Theory, Algorithms, Java Programming, Java, Data Management, Secure Coding, Theoretical Computer Science, Performance Tuning, Computer Programming
Mittel ·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: Cloud Deployment, Software Development Methodologies, Open Web Application Security Project (OWASP), CI/CD, Application Deployment, DevOps, Development Environment, Continuous Integration, Ansible, TCP/IP, Docker (Software), OSI Models, General Networking, Networking Hardware, Computing Platforms, Application Programming Interface (API), Version Control, IT Automation, Software Design Patterns, JSON
Mittel · Spezialisierung · 1–3 Monate

Kompetenzen, die Sie erwerben: Java, Java Programming, File I/O, Object Oriented Programming (OOP), Object Oriented Design, Data Structures, Computer Programming, Android Development, Application Development, Programming Principles, Program Development, Problem Solving
Anfänger · Kurs · 1–3 Monate

Mittel ·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: Unreal Engine, Virtual Environment, 3D Assets, Game Design, Post-Production, Image Quality, Model Optimization, Data Import/Export
Gemischt ·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: Rust (Programming Language), Command-Line Interface, Other Programming Languages, Package and Software Management, Memory Management, Go (Programming Language), Programming Principles, Program Development, C (Programming Language), Secure Coding, Software Development, Computer Programming
Mittel · angeleitetes Projekt · Weniger als 2 Stunden

Kompetenzen, die Sie erwerben: Anwendungs-Rahmenwerke, Plattformübergreifende Entwicklung, Mobile Entwicklungstools, Mobile Entwicklung, Android-Entwicklung, Entwicklungsumgebung, Flutter (Software), UI-Komponenten, Apple iOS
Anfänger · Projekt · Weniger als 2 Stunden

Kompetenzen, die Sie erwerben: Email Automation, Automation, Application Programming Interface (API), Gmail, Data Access, Python Programming, Data Import/Export, Key Management
Mittel · Kurs · 1–3 Monate

Kompetenzen, die Sie erwerben: Algorithmen, Rust (Programmiersprache), Daten-Strukturen, Software-Entwicklung, Anwendungsprogrammierschnittstelle (API), Spiel-Design, Grundsätze der Programmierung, Entwicklung von Videospielen
Anfänger · angeleitetes Projekt · Weniger als 2 Stunden

Kompetenzen, die Sie erwerben: Version Control, Unity Engine, GitHub, Bitbucket, Android Development, C# (Programming Language), Game Design, Mobile Development, Video Game Development, Software Versioning, Scripting, User Interface (UI), 3D Assets, Animation and Game Design, User Interface (UI) Design, Computer Graphics, Graphics Software, Animations, Graphical Tools, Application Deployment
Anfänger · Spezialisierung · 3–6 Monate